Before we dive into the tips, it’s essential to understand the fundamentals of golf. A good golf swing involves a combination of balance, tempo, and technique. It’s crucial to maintain a consistent swing plane, transfer your weight correctly, and make solid contact with the ball. Proper ball position, grip pressure, and alignment are also vital elements of a good golf swing. By focusing on these fundamentals, you’ll be able to develop a solid foundation for your game and make significant improvements at the driving range.

Tips for Improving Your Golf Swing at the Driving Range

Here are 10 golf driving range Calgary tips to help you improve your game:

  1. Start with a warm-up routine: Before you begin hitting balls, make sure to stretch and warm up your muscles. This will help prevent injuries and get your blood flowing.
  2. Focus on your grip: A good grip is essential for a consistent golf swing. Experiment with different grip pressures and styles to find what works best for you.
  3. Practice with purpose: Don't just hit balls aimlessly. Set specific goals for your practice session, such as working on your driver or iron play.
  4. Use video analysis to improve your swing: Many driving ranges in Calgary offer video analysis technology. Use this tool to record your swing and identify areas for improvement.
  5. Work on your short game: The short game is a critical part of golf. Practice your chipping, pitching, and putting to develop a well-rounded game.
  6. Develop a pre-shot routine: A consistent pre-shot routine can help you stay focused and prepared for each shot. Experiment with different routines to find what works best for you.
  7. Practice under pressure: Simulate game-like conditions by practicing under pressure. This will help you develop the mental toughness and resilience you need to perform well on the course.
  8. Use training aids to improve your swing: There are many training aids available that can help you improve your golf swing. Experiment with different aids to find what works best for you.
  9. Seek instruction from a professional: If you're struggling with your game, consider seeking instruction from a professional golf instructor. They can provide personalized feedback and help you develop a customized practice plan.
  10. Stay hydrated and fueled: Practicing at the driving range can be physically demanding. Make sure to stay hydrated and fueled with healthy snacks and drinks.

What is the best way to improve my golf swing at the driving range?

+

The best way to improve your golf swing at the driving range is to practice with purpose and focus on specific aspects of your game. Set goals for your practice session, such as working on your driver or iron play, and use video analysis and training aids to help you improve.

How often should I practice at the driving range to see improvement?

+

The frequency of your practice sessions will depend on your individual goals and schedule. However, it’s generally recommended to practice at least 2-3 times per week to see significant improvement. Consistency is key, so try to establish a regular practice routine and stick to it.
